Brightwater is partnering in a national research project to improve supported decision-making for people with dementia and acquired disability. The project, led by NeuRA and supported by Brightwater, will develop tools and training aligned with upcoming aged care reforms.

Brightwater mourns the passing of Dr Penny Flett AO, a visionary leader who transformed aged care, disability services and community health in Australia.
